All About Dogwood

Category: Container Gardening | Posted: Mon Nov 23, 2009 3:46 pm

Red osier dogwood is just the best plant for this time of year - cut down some branches - you can find them in fields and ditches and then place them in garden pots or containers. Fill the over-season containers with soil to hold the stems. Attach some of those low voltage bulbs and you are all set for a fine looking decoration to brighten up those dull Winter days.
